Joao Felix (From Benfica to Atletico Madrid)
€126 million
The Portuguese can play as a top striker and as a winger. Perhaps that's why his price tag was high. Atletico Madrid had to bid for him when they saw the possibility of Griezmann leaving. Felix is still very young. In fact, he played only a season in Benfica's senior team before leaving. The nineteen years old performed brilliantly in just that season.
Antoine Griezmann (from Atletico Madrid to Barcelona)
€120 million
Greizmann has played all his club career matches in Spain. He started from Real Sociedad, then to Atletico Madrid and finally landed in his dream team, according to him, Barcelona. He will be another great addition to the almost perfect Barcelona team and possibly give them what they actually need.
Eden Hazard (from Chelsea to Real Madrid)
€100 million
The Spanish clubs are actually spending the most money this time around. Hazard had only few months left in his Chelsea's contract, so they had to sell him before it expires. Otherwise, he will be leaving for free. Real Madrid got him this summer with the hope of being their Ronaldo that left. Would Hazard ignite the spirit of Real Madrid players? It's only a matter of time to find out. By the way, he is a great player and a big addition to the team.
Lucas Hernandez (from Atletico Madrid to Bayern Munich)
€80 million
This is another player that left Atletico Madrid for another team. Lucas is a record signing for Bayern Munich and the world of football, as far as defenders' transfers is concerned. A whooping €80 million was spent in bringing the French man to Bayern Munich. Another good addition to the team.
Frenkie de Jong (from Ajax to Barcelona)
€75 million
De Jong's transfer had been finalised even before the end of last season, but it became official on the first of June, this year. We can't tell how the coach will handle all these players, but he sure got the quality players he needs. De Jong was among Ajax underrated team last season and he performed brilliantly. Hopefully, he will bring that great form to Barcelona.
Rodri Hernandez (from Atletico Madrid to Manchester City)
€70 million
Once again, Guardiola strengthens his midfield by bringing in another good midfielder from Atletico Madrid. Rodri has always been in a good form in the Spanish league, so his price was definitely worth it considering the fact that the market prices are now extremely high. This is probably the most expensive signing in England this summer currently.
Luka Jovic (from Frankfurt to Real Madrid)
€60 million
Jovic is a striker, a good one at that. Real Madrid is gradually restructing the team and fixing everywhere fixable. Jovic would be another great addition and would complement Hazard. If there's another team and player to watch out for next season, Real Madrid and Jovic should be among. The Serbian was bought from Frankfurt.
Tanguy Ndombele (from Lyon to Tottenham)
€60 million
He fits into Pochetino's pattern a lot, so bringing him in at this price was inevitable. Tottenham broke their transfer record to bring him into the team. Let's hope it's worth it. Ndombele did great last season and he is currently aged 22. He has a lot of time to improve and be a great addition to the team.
Eder Miltao (from Porto to Real Madrid)
€50 million
FC Porto made a lot from this guy's transfer, I must confess. They got him from Sao Paulo at €7 million. After playing one season with them, Real Madrid got interested in him and offered times 7 the amount Porto got him. Miltao can play as a right back and as a right back. It's obvious Real Madrid are trying to fix their back line and front line.
Aaron Wan-Bissaka (from Crystal Palace to Manchester United)
€49.5 million
Manchester United were expected to spend a lot this season since the team is rumored to have a lot of bad players. They haven't brought in much so far. Wan Bissaka, a right back from Crystal Palace is currently their highest transfer fee this summer. Well, the transfer market is still open. Let's wait and see what the rest of the days brings.
